IDK on the inexpensive digital brand new. I think we're all waiting for those lol. But an analog MB elec 30 has a 1,500 watt element, dbl wall for higher heat vs foam insulation with the mb Mes 30/40 that melts in the element area and burns. I'd get the analog new for a parts oven with dial on max and plugged into a pid.

ok. Thanks Dr K and Steve. So how do I tell I’m getting the analog with 1500 element?
The analog MB smoker has a rheostat dial controller like an electric skillet and comes with 4 legs and a 1,500 watt element as disclosed on the smoker. It is double wall insulated but hollow so it should sound hollow when you flick it with your finger. All Mes with a digital controller have foam insulation in the cabinet and door even the windowed doors. The Mes 30 has an 800 watt element and the 40 is 1,200 but max at 275 if it actually gets there because the foam can start burning as seen in a lot of picks with the back removed and even pushing the sheet metal inside the smoker around the element in the right rear corner you can hear a crunchy sound. With the analog set to max and an plugged into a PID you can get higher temps.
